Carvana is an easy-to-use, online-only car buying service that lets you view each car in 360-degree view and offers touchless delivery right to your driveway. All vehicles sold on Carvana have been inspected and reconditioned by qualified technicians. They come with a 7-day money-back guarantee and complimentary limited warranty for 100 days, or 4,189 miles, whichever comes first.

The whole process is super easy — just find the car you like, enter your method of payment, (this can include a trade-in as a down payment), upload the necessary documents and choose to add additional coverage or protection if needed, then you can select delivery or pickup! It’s that easy, and you have 7 days to return it if you don’t like it. See how it works here.

When gas prices are high, you can save a lot of money with these hybrid & electric cars. Imagine having a car with over 120 mpg! At the time of this writing, there is a 2014 Mitsubishi i-MiEV for $9,590, a 2014 Chevy Spark for $10,590 and a 2016 Nissan Leaf for $10,990. However, availability may depend on your location. These cars may sell quickly, so get one while supplies last! Note that on these older hybrid and electric vehicles, the battery may need to be replaced if it hasn’t been already, so you’ll want to factor in that cost before purchase.
